What Makes a Great Teacher?
“Parents have always worried about where to send their children to school; but the school, statistically speaking, does not matter as much as which adult stands in front of their children. Teacher quality tends to vary more within schools—even supposedly good schools—than among schools.
But we have never identified excellent teachers in any reliable, objective way. Instead, we tend to ascribe their gifts to some mystical quality that we can recognize and revere—but not replicate. The great teacher serves as a hero but never, ironically, as a lesson.”
Are their personal characteristics that good teachers tend to have? Teach for America, according to this article, values perseverance. For instance, they may value an applicant to their program who had a mediocre GPA in the beginning and continued to rise in comparison to someone who always had a high GPA.
The article implicitly brings to mind an issue: many of the best and brightest teachers do not want to stay in the classroom for long. They want to be administrators or start their own schools or work for Teach for America.
